LongDescription#@#NA#@@#Cleaning Instructions#@#To clean the Multiplex 424-CF-S36-1525 beverage valve, first disconnect it from power. Use a damp cloth with mild detergent to wipe the exterior. Ensure no debris obstructs the valve openings. Rinse with clean water and dry thoroughly. Regular cleaning prevents bacteria buildup, reduces fire hazards, and maintains efficiency, saving on utility costs. Inspect the valve for wear and replace if necessary. Keeping it clean ensures compliance with health standards and extends its lifespan.#@@#Additional Info#@#The Multiplex 424-CF-S36-1525 2.5" W Flomatic Post-Mix Beverage Valve offers dependable performance for beverage dispensing in commercial environments. • Delivery times may vary based on location.#@@#deliverynotes#@#Upon confirmation of completed payment, Culinary Depot will ship/deliver the Multiplex 424-CF-S36-1525 Flomatic Post-Mix Beverage Valve.#@@#Maintenance Guide#@#To ensure optimal performance of the Multiplex 424-CF-S36-1525 2.5" W Flomatic Post-Mix Beverage Valve, conduct regular inspections for wear or damage. Clean the valve with a soft cloth and mild detergent to prevent buildup. Check connections for leaks and tighten as needed. Replace worn seals to maintain efficiency. Ensure the valve operates within the specified pressure range to avoid malfunctions.
